Instructions
Print at least 1 "Break_Loom_v3_Barb", and 3 "Break_Loom_v3". The "Break_Loom_v3r" model can be used to created larger loom shapes. Print it sturdy. The spires have integral supports built into them. They require an unnecessary force for knitting to break. Extra walls, and at least .2 infill should suffice. Your gcode may treat the female connecter oddly. It is ok if the circular part prints funky. The inner ring is more of a guide for the sturdy outside supports.
